The 2026 “Must-Sip” Indie Wine Route

The 2026 season is all about the “New Wave” of winemakers. Your private tour should include:

  • Closson Chase: Iconic for its bright purple barn and world-class Chardonnay.

  • Hinterland Wine Company: The destination for sparkling wine enthusiasts. Their 2026 releases are already the talk of the Ontario sommelier circuit.

  • Traynor Family Vineyard: For the traveler looking for low-intervention, experimental “natural” wines that define the modern PEC soul.

Culinary Excellence: Beyond the Tasting Room

The County’s food scene has reached a fever pitch in 2026.

  • Lunch at Bocado: A Spanish-inspired gem in Picton that focuses on seasonal County ingredients.

  • Dinner at Theia: The newest farm-to-table wine bar that offers an intimate, high-concept dining experience.

  • The Royal Hotel: Even if you aren’t staying overnight, a stop at their terrace for a cocktail is a 2026 “bucket list” item.
